MARDI GRAS<br />
Photo by: Bruno Passigatti/Shutterstock<br />
February 9, 2016<br />
New Orleans,<br />
Louisiana<br />
Over-consumption, ribaldness, and revelry are key features, and<br />
few places do it like Mardi Gras in New Orleans.<br />
With a motto of Laissez les bons temps rouler (Let the good times roll), it’s no surprise that Mardi Gras is probably the<br />
wildest party in the United States. New Orleans is home to half-a-dozen cultures and dialects, and this all-inclusive event<br />
has something for everyone, from colorful, family-friendly parades and jazz-inspired music to uninhibited parties and timehonored<br />
traditions. So don your purple, green and gold—the festival’s official colors representing justice, faith and power—<br />

SXSW has evolved from a small indie film fest into the preeminent conference-slashfestival,<br />
highlighting the latest in the film, music, and tech industries.<br />
SXSW<br />
March 11–20, 2016<br />
Austin, Texas<br />
What started as a weekend music festival now sprawls across 10 days,<br />
encompassing music, technology and film; this is South by Southwest (SXSW). Its<br />
massive influx of concerts, parties and conferences still draw tens of thousands<br />
of attendees. While SXSW does not favor the unprepared, it does reward the<br />
spontaneous. Decide who’s on the schedule you want to see, but don’t be too<br />
attached to your plans—you never know when an invitation to an amazing showcase<br />
or surprise concert will come your way. In the last decade or so, the festival has<br />
expanded to include film and technology. The film program has become one of the<br />
nation’s premier film festivals and runs nearly every day of SXSW (think of it like a<br />
domestic version of the Cannes Film Festival). The tech community takes over SXSW<br />
for 5 days with Interactive, a series of conference and panels.<br />
